I plan on hosting the B.E.S.T. event again in October. And I have applied to have our club host one leg of the Curtis Youngblood Stingray races. For those that don t know, Curtis Youngblood produces a quadcopter with variable pitch and hosts a racing league for them. He shows up with all the needed items for the day and even has spares for demos. It should be a huge draw and a lot of fun. Sam: Power relays installed on the 12V power supply. Round plug is the 100A supply and standard plug is the 50A supply. The relay controls both supplies. There is a need for weed control in the runway as small weeds are poking thru the petro-mat. It was brought up that we need to replace the ceiling fan in the impound area and the others that are outdoors most likely need to be replaced as well. Gary will look into it. Gary B: All fire extinguishers were checked out for their annual inspection. One was found to have been used and hung back up empty by a member. We need to notify the officers when one is used so that it can be replaced. New AMA magazine has the 2014 rule changes. Those that fly GPS and stabilized craft such as quads should look at rule 560. Those that fly FPV should look at rule 550 Sam: We have 168 members with 23 joining in Robert transferred the president and vice president duties to Kirk Jensen and Keith Jarvis.
